Yes I have to agree, this happens to all types of children. I remember an article of a girl who lives in Mississauga (born and raised) has been Missing for over 2 years now. They think she is in a human traffic ring in Mississauga. The way they explained it in the article is, they prey on young teens, any teen. The assaulter is usually a young man, they become their boyfriend, slowly get them involved in drugs, keep them out at night, changing the child behavior. Then one night they lock them up in an apartment or house never to be seen by the public again. The parents don't have much to give to the police cause their child has become unpredictable, by the time the parent report the child missing and the police confirm it. The child would have been missing for a while, leaving it hard to trace tracks and then she magically disappears, vanishes, there are no traces. She willingly enters a home with her boyfriend there is nothing suspicious for anyone see. By the time they air the missing teen 2 weeks later, no one remembers a girl entering a house. This is how they traffic Canadian raised children. Immigration children is another story. Both are very sad stories and our laws do not protect any of these children. When and if caught the men get a slap on the wrist and walk, meanwhile the girls lives are destroyed.

Alot of foreign women are promised jobs in U.S., Canada, Israel, etc that are from countries such as Phillipines and former Eastern Block countries. They think they will be nannies, models, etc and instead are forced to become strippers and hookers. It is a huge problem...

Not to mention all the Canadian born children & teens who are vulnerable to predators such as pimps, etc.
